The ideal walk-in shower for seniors prioritizes safety and ease of use. Key features include a low entry threshold, integrated seating, and secure grab bars. Non-slip flooring and accessible controls are also critical. This design promotes independence and confidence for seniors in Iowa.
Medicare generally does not cover walk-in showers as a standard home improvement. However, if a walk-in shower is deemed medically necessary to address a specific health condition, some limited coverage might be available. It is advisable to confirm directly with Medicare for your individual circumstances.
